Solid wood flooring requires careful maintenance. Think of it as the elegant centerpiece of your home’s interior design. Over time, it can become more delicate and prone to damage if not properly cared for. To keep it looking its best, avoid dragging heavy or sharp objects across the surface. When moving furniture, always use protective pads under the legs to prevent scratches.
For light-colored solid wood floors in the bedroom, extra care is needed. Avoid using harsh cleaning tools like knives or abrasive cloths to remove stains. Instead, gently wipe with a soft cloth. If water spills on the floor, dry it immediately with a clean, dry cloth to prevent moisture from seeping into the wood. Before installation, make sure to lay down a moisture barrier and avoid using wet or unseasoned wood, which can warp over time.
During the Lunar New Year, when family and friends gather, it's common for kids to spill drinks or food on the floor. For water-soluble stains, first sweep away any loose dirt, then use rice water or orange peel water to gently clean the area. If something sticky like syrup or ink gets on the floor, act quickly—wipe it off with a cloth dampened in furniture wax before it soaks into the wood. For minor burns from cigarette butts, a similar method with furniture wax can help restore the finish.
Sanitary fixtures such as toilets and basins are used frequently during the holiday season. To avoid clogs, never flush items like paper towels, tissues, or sanitary products down the toilet. If small objects fall into the toilet, remove them promptly with a plunger or a suction cup. Avoid using rough materials or hitting the ceramic surfaces, as this can cause cracks or chips.
When cleaning the bathtub, use only neutral detergents or soap and water. Avoid strong chemicals like bath essences or sulfur-based cleaners, which can damage the enamel. For stubborn stains in the non-slip areas, a liquid cleaner works well. For stains like red mercury or rust, first wipe with alcohol, then clean with a mild detergent. For wax or polish marks, use industrial alcohol followed by a gentle wash. Never use scouring pads, as they can scratch the surface.
Tiles in the kitchen and bathroom need regular attention. Use a multi-purpose decontamination cream to clean the porcelain without damaging it. For grout lines, use a toothbrush and some of the same cream to scrub away dirt, then apply a waterproofing agent to prevent mold and water seepage. If tiles become loose or cracked, especially during busy holidays, consider using resin-based adhesives and waterproofing agents to ensure long-term durability.
For walls, especially those with non-waterproof coatings, use a rubber eraser or a damp cloth with cleaning solution to remove graffiti or stains. Don’t let dirt sit too long, as it can leave permanent marks. Always wipe the wall surface gently and dry it thoroughly after cleaning to maintain its appearance.
